os3.9 Mediator Startup times.....
Ok I need your startup times to see if my system is abnormally slow. My Hardware specs are in my sig.
I use OS3.9, 3.1 roms. Warpup with Warp3D on a Picasso96 Voodoo3. I boot into 800x600 16bit. My WB from Cold boots in 1min 48secs. How does this compare to similar systems out there? TIA

Ok, I disabled ID0. I also turned on Synchronous for the HDD. Boot time from cold is now 55secs +/- 2 seconds, I have shaved almost a minute from my boot time!
This is a great improvement! Thanks all! ![]() I aint done yet either! Any other suggestions?

@DDNI
Really no difference*. Empty connectors don't have any effect. If you move the terminator up the chain you just won't be able to use the connectors after it. * Of course, cable length, the speed of electrons, etc. But, no practical difference. |

Fixed my slow delete bu using setcache from sfs archive and adding 400 buffers to each partition...!
